Functionality and mode of action of arginine:
L-arginine is a semi-essential amino acid, making its intake vital in certain life situations (e.g., in children and adolescents). Arginine is one of the basic amino acids and is ideally suited to an alkaline diet.
The main focus for athletes, however, is the fact that arginine is the sole precursor to nitric oxide (nitric oxide). Nitric oxide is considered a vasodilator, which athletes consider beneficial because it is associated with increased tissue blood flow. For this reason, L-arginine (or arginine compounds) is considered a basic pre-workout supplement.
